Where do the pupillary motor fibers split off to become independent from the vision pathway?
Just before the Lateral Geniculate Nucleus (LGN)
Which of the conditions below may cause a dilated pupil with an afferent pupillary light reflex deficit?
Chronic glaucoma with optic nerve atrophy
Which of the following conditions may cause a dilated pupil with an efferent pupillary light reflex deficit (select all that apply)?
Iris atrophy, Posterior synechia, Parasympathetic denervation
TRUE OR FALSE: With an efferent pupillary light reflex deficit OD, you would have loss of vision OD.
false
What effect would a right visual cortex lesion have on the pupillary light reflexes (PLR)?
No effect; the PLRs would be normal in both eyes

Match each muscle with the correct innervation; put in just the Cranial Nerve number (use regular numbers not Roman numerals).
Dorsal (Superior) Rectus:
Ventral Rectus
Lateral Rectus:
Medial Rectus:
Dorsal (Superior) Oblique:
Ventral Oblique:
Retractor Bulbi:
Dorsal (Superior) Rectus: 3
Ventral Rectus: 3
Lateral Rectus: 6
Medial Rectus: 3
Dorsal (Superior) Oblique: 4
Ventral Oblique: 3
Retractor Bulbi: 6
